How good is your hospital at managing cardiac problems?

The US Department of Health and Human Services recently launched a website to help you find out.

The website, Hospital Compare, allows you to view various quality measures on how well doctors working in specific hospitals are managing patients who have myocardial infarctions (heart attacks) and heart failure (as well as pneumonia,) and compares their performance to other hospitals in your region and across the country. The site does not give information on individual doctors, but shows you how the "aggregate" of doctors who manage these conditions are performing in your hospital.

The site also provides information on your rights as a patient, and on the Health Quality Alliance, a collaborative organization that compiled the data appearing on this site.

The Hospital Compare website is: http://www.hospitalcompare.hhs.gov/.
